{"id":535731,"date":"2026-04-02T01:12:16","date_gmt":"2026-04-02T01:12:16","guid":{"rendered":"https:\/\/www.rawchili.com\/nhl\/535731\/"},"modified":"2026-04-02T01:12:16","modified_gmt":"2026-04-02T01:12:16","slug":"blackhawks-news-rumors-injury-updates-frondell-physicality-more-the-hockey-writers-chicago-blackhawks","status":"publish","type":"post","link":"https:\/\/www.rawchili.com\/nhl\/535731\/","title":{"rendered":"Blackhawks News &#038; Rumors: Injury Updates, Frondell, Physicality &#038; More &#8211; The Hockey Writers &#8211; Chicago Blackhawks"},"content":{"rendered":"<p>The <a href=\"https:\/\/thehockeywriters.com\/docs\/chicago-blackhawks\/\" rel=\"nofollow noopener\" target=\"_blank\">Chicago Blackhawks<\/a> returned home from a four-game road trip that didn\u2019t go their way, as they went 1-3.<\/p>\n<p>But their game against the Winnipeg Jets on March 31 brought a newsy 24 hours, including Anton Frondell\u2019s first game at the United Center and significant injury updates, as the Blackhawks are without Matt Grzelyck, Artyom Levshunov, Oliver Moore, and Andrew Mangiapane.<\/p>\n<p>Here is the latest as they embark on another (and final) three-game road trip. <\/p>\n<p>Injury Updates<\/p>\n<p>Head coach Jeff Blashill announced on March 31 that Grzelyck, who sustained an injury on March 22, and Levshunov, who is dealing with a hand fracture, will miss the remainder of the season.<\/p>\n<p>Meanwhile, regarding the forward injuries, Andrew Mangiapane, who has been dealing with an upper-body injury since March 19, will travel with the team on their three-game road trip. Blashill said he won\u2019t play against the Edmonton Oilers on April 2, but noted, \u201cwe\u2019re hoping to have him at some point on the trip, though.\u201d <\/p>\n<p>With<a href=\"https:\/\/thehockeywriters.com\/docs\/oliver-moore\/\" rel=\"nofollow noopener\" target=\"_blank\"> Oliver Moore<\/a>, who has been out since March 8, his return status is up in the air. Blashill said, \u201cIf he gets in, it would be just at the very end. So, we\u2019re not sure. We\u2019re still kind of waiting for final say on that, but it\u2019s somewhat likely that he won\u2019t be available the rest of the year. If he was available, it would be at the end.\u201d<\/p>\n<p>The Blackhawks are missing all four players, but development in the final games will remain the focal point as players take on increased roles. Kevin Korchinski was recalled from Rockford. So, he and Ethan Del Mastro have been getting extended looks, and prospects Sacha Boisvert and Anton Frondell have been able to slot in to help on offense. <\/p>\n<p>Frondell\u2019s Impressive Debut<\/p>\n<p>Frondell has had a great start to his NHL career. It\u2019s a very small sample size, but in five games, he has five points, including his first NHL goal at home against the Jets. A dream come true, and happy to do it in my first home game.\u201d<\/p>\n<p>Blackhawks \u201cFight\u201d Practice <\/p>\n<p>The talking point of the week was that some Blackhawks<a href=\"https:\/\/x.com\/BlackhawksFocus\/status\/2038659829791613284?s=20\" rel=\"nofollow\"> players practiced fighting<\/a>, and one of their pro scouts, Wade Brookbank was there to assist them. <\/p>\n<p>I asked Del Mastro about the practice. It only included a few players, and he mentioned they enjoyed it. <\/p>\n<p>\u201cI think it was just something that, you know, we want to work on for a while. I mean, it wasn\u2019t as much as maybe, like, looked like fight club. It was more so just kind of being able to be comfortable in maybe those situations. You know, we have a lot of young guys that haven\u2019t obviously played a ton of pro hockey. So, I think it\u2019s nice to be able to have someone to come out and talk to us about certain ways to defend yourselves, and become more comfortable in that situation. Because, you know, hockey is a violent sport. It happens a lot more than you think\u2026 a lot of the D were out there, and we want to be able to add that to our game and be comfortable with it. So, I think that was huge to kind of be able to just, you know, grapple a little bit, and be more comfortable in that setting.\u201d<\/p>\n<p class=\"has-text-align-center\">Related: <a href=\"https:\/\/thehockeywriters.com\/5-things-to-watch-as-the-blackhawks-season-winds-down\/\" rel=\"nofollow noopener\" target=\"_blank\">5 Things to Watch as the Blackhawks\u2019 Season Winds Down<\/a><\/p>\n<p>In the game against the Jets, they were outhit 27-20, but 20 was more than they had in their last four games, during which their high was 17 hits against the New York Islanders on March 24.<\/p>\n<p>It doesn\u2019t mean the Blackhawks are going to turn into some wrecking ball team, but it\u2019s something they are taking to heart and are eager to improve on.<\/p>\n<p>Boisvert Returns to Lineup <\/p>\n<p>Sacha Boisvert was made a healthy scratch against the Jets after making his NHL debut on March 26. It got Sam Lafferty back in the lineup, but Blashill also noted the benefit of Boisvert watching as a good learning experience. He did that this season with players like Levshunov and Del Mastro, too. <\/p>\n<p>But Boisvert will return to the lineup. <\/p>\n<p>Blashill had this to say about Boisvert on April 1, \u201cFirst of all, Sasha, I thought he got better in the three games that he played. He\u2019ll play again in Edmonton. So, you know, we\u2019ll get him back in a couple games in a row, hopefully. And I thought he got more comfortable, as was to be expected. Brought some physicality, but also, like, he\u2019s got good play with the puck. He probably hasn\u2019t had the opportunity to get a shot off as much\u2026 You can tell he\u2019s got a really good shot, too. Obviously, got in a fight, which shows his toughness. So, yeah, you know, I think he\u2019s done a good job.\u201d <\/p>\n<p>Gajan Signs With Blackhawks <\/p>\n<p>The Blackhawks announced they signed goaltender Adam Gajan <a href=\"https:\/\/www.nhl.com\/blackhawks\/news\/release-blackhawks-sign-adam-gajan-to-two-year-entry-level-contract\" rel=\"nofollow noopener\" target=\"_blank\">to a two-year entry-level deal.<\/a> He was a 2023 second-round pick and is coming from the University of Minnesota-Duluth, where he went 19-13-1 in 33 games, with a 2.25 goals-against average and a .908 save percentage. <\/p>\n<p>Scott Powers of The Athletic reported Gajan \u201c<a href=\"https:\/\/x.com\/ByScottPowers\/status\/2039369625113088218?s=20\" rel=\"nofollow\">is expected to sign an ATO or PTO <\/a>and join the IceHogs this season.\u201d <\/p>\n<p>The 21-year-old joins a crowded goalie group mainly including Drew Commesso, Arvid S\u00f6derblom, and Spencer Knight. But having a lot of goalies with potential is a good problem to have.
